Transaction 59424e930733fe63c6051f7a158586511b55819f8d2839eded8825a1d110bc6a
1 Input
1 Output
-
59424e930733fe63c6051f7a158586511b55819f8d2839eded8825a1d110bc6a:0
- value
- 6019541
- script pubkey
- OP_0 OP_PUSHBYTES_20 96764915b68e12f4441c7572df776d6c225dc4aa
- address
- bc1qjemyj9dk3cf0g3quw4ed7amdds39m392rgdu23